WebWear-free. posi tilt® inclination sensors offer contactless, wear-free, and absolute measurement of tilt angles ranging up to ±180°. The use of MEMS technology makes these sensors particularly resistant to shock, vibrations, and contamination. As a result, posi tilt® inclination sensors are ideal for use in outdoor applications. WebFeb 2, 2024 · Elevation grade (or slope) is the steepness, or degree of inclination, of a certain area of land.It can simply be the steepness between two specific points in a given area, the average of an area's gradual change in steepness, or an erratic variation in the elevation of the ground. We usually measure the ground's elevation as its altitude above sea level.

ASM … WebJun 12, 2024 · The plane of the Moon's orbit around the Earth is only tilted about 5 degrees or so from the ecliptic plane. The pair of points at which the Moon's orbit crosses the ecliptic plane (the orbital nodes) slowly rotate around the earth every 18.6 years or so. WebAug 15, 2024 · Inclined orbit operation of geostationary satellites. Explanation of how geostationary satellites eventually run short of fuel and start to move north-south and how tracking antenna may be used to extend operational life. Once placed accurately into its geostationary orbit position the inclination gradually increases, so it starts to drift ...
